Firefighters are mopping up after a vehicle fire spread to nearby bushland along the Kwinana Freeway in Baldivis on Sunday.
A white SUV caught alight around 12.40pm in the southbound lanes of the freeway just after the Karnup Road exit.
The flames then sparked a bushfire which prompted an advice warning for motorists and nearby residents.

The Kwinana Freeway was also closed in both directions causing massive delays for drivers.
Around 5.50pm, the fire was contained and controlled.
It had burnt through 11.5 hectares.
It's understood no one was injured.
